Let's start with the basics: what even is a paper living room table? It sounds like a craft project, right? But here's the twist: this isn't your kid's school poster board. We're talking about high-strength paper tubes—engineered to be tough, not flimsy—held together by clever 3-way and 4-way connectors that lock into place like puzzle pieces. Add a set of plastic foot covers to keep moisture at bay, and suddenly, "paper furniture" stops sounding like a novelty and starts sounding like a solution.

Feature Traditional Wooden Side Table MINHOU UNIMAX Paper Side Table
Assembly Time 45-60 minutes (with tools) 5-10 minutes (no tools)
Weight 15-20 kg (needs 2 people to carry) 2.5-3.5 kg (one hand, easy peasy)
Carbon Footprint High (wood harvesting, transportation) 80% lower (recycled materials, local production)
Moving Convenience Bulky, hard to fit in small cars Flat-packed, fits in a backpack (yes, really)

But what about water and moisture? We know, paper and spills don't sound like a match made in heaven. That's why the table's surface is treated with a special coating to repel minor spills (think coffee splashes, not a flood), and those plastic foot covers? They lift the table off the ground, keeping it safe from damp floors. Pro tip: keep your room's humidity below 60% (most air conditioners or dehumidifiers can handle that), and this table will stick around for years.
